The short films Bus Story by Jorge Yúdice, The Cake (La tarta) by Fernando Sánchez, The Drunkard's Walk (El andar del borracho) by Pol Armengol, and Voyage Spatial (Viaje espacial intergaláctico) by Guillermo A. Chaia are about to begin their participation at the 5th ClujShorts 2017 International Short Film Festival, which is annually held in the town of Cluj-Napoca (Transylvania, Romania). The ClujShorts of the current year 2017 is starting today, Monday 3rd April, and will end on Sunday 9th.
The screening of these short films are scheduled according to the following timetable:
| Short Film | Date | Time |
| The Drunkard's Walk by Pol Armengol | Wednesday 5th April | 17:00 hours |
| Bus Story by Jorge Yúdice | Thursday 6th April | 13:00 hours |
| The Cake by Fernando Sánchez | Thursday 6th April | 21:00 hours |
| Voyage Spatial by Guillermo A. Chaia | Friday 7th April | 15:00 hours |
In total, the ClujShorts 2017 has selected 158 short films from the submitted ones. Four of this selected films are, of course, Bus Story by Jorge Yúdice, The Cake by Fernando Sánchez, The Drunkard's Walk by Pol Armengol, and Voyage Spatial by Guillermo A. Chaia. The 158 selected shorts, including the four short films promoted at film festivals by [ The House of Films ], are going to compete for the Audience Award of the current fifth edition of the ClujShorts.

For their part, the Jury of the ClujShorts 2017 has just nominated 52 international short films for fighting in the Official Competition of this edition. These finalists will fight for the rest of the awards of this festival and among them, also The Drunkard's Walk, the short film directed by Pol Armengol, which has entered into this year's Official Competition.
